epal batter Kushal Bhurtel smashed one of the most destructive knocks in the history of T20 International Cricket as he smashed a ton in just 35 balls during the Asian Games Men’s T20I Qualifier against China. The extraordinary knock helped Nepal reach a huge total of 313/2.
16 sixes and record-breaking knock
Bhurtel smashed 129 runs in just 43 balls – his knock included 5 fours and 16 sixes. He played the innings with a staggering strike rate of 300 and he completely dismantled Chinese bowling attack. The Nepal batter reached his century in just 35 balls and this is one of the fastest centuries in T20I history.
Six sixes in a single over
One of the highlight of the match was in the 9th over when Kushal smashed six sixes in a single over. With that feat, he joined an elite list of batters that includes Yuvraj Singh, Kieron Pollard and Dipendra Singh Airee who have achieved the rare milestone in international cricket.
